7. Best Practices

General account security awareness applies to any exchange profile, whether it is being studied, evaluated or used. Common best practices include using hardware-backed multi-factor authentication, maintaining unique strong passwords through a reputable password manager and being alert to phishing attempts that impersonate platform domains.

Awareness of withdrawal whitelisting, anti-phishing codes and session monitoring is broadly encouraged by major exchanges, including Binance. These controls are widely available across the buy crypto accounts marketplace because they materially reduce the impact of credential-related incidents.

From a usage perspective, it is good practice to keep separation between long-term storage, active trading balances and on-platform earn products. This separation reduces blast radius if a single layer of the system experiences an issue, regardless of which platform is being discussed.

Documentation hygiene also matters. Maintaining clear records of legitimate activities, transactions and counterparties supports compliance reviews and aligns with the standards that mature exchanges expect. This is true across every product on a venue like Binance.
